Our current sole supplier has performed reliably, but capacity constraints and regional logistics risks make a second source prudent. Branch managers should note that qualification trials will run for two quarters, and no customer-facing commitments should reference the new source until certification completes. Timelines and evaluation criteria are maintained on the linked subpages. The commercial rationale appears in the note below.

board note of fahif-yahog: Gross margin on Wenath came in at 10 percent against a plan of 5 percent. Only 3 of the 100 pilot accounts renewed Wenath, so a churn review is set for July 15.

## Deployment

The Lumacache image service has a known slow leak in its thumbnail cache layer: evicted entries keep a reference alive through the decoder pool, so resident memory creeps up roughly 40 MB per hour under steady load. Until the refactor in the Harkness branch lands, we mitigate by capping pool size and scheduling a rolling restart every 12 hours. Deploy with the supervisor, never bare, or the restart hook won't fire. The deployment relies on the configuration values listed below.

settings of bagug-tahof:
holath:
  pin: 7837
  metrics_host: metrics.holath.tolvaqsys.internal
  tenant: quenath
  seal: seal_6001b3af

## Deploying the Gatewick Proctor Queue

Deploys are pretty painless: push to main, wait for the pipeline, then watch the queue drain dashboard for five minutes. If candidates pile up mid-exam, roll back first and ask questions later — the queue replays safely. Everything the workers care about lives in one config block, shown here for reference.

settings of bafof-yagef:
JOROX_PIN=8740
JOROX_TENANT=pelox
JOROX_METRICS_HOST=metrics.jorox.qorvelworks.internal
JOROX_SEAL=seal_c78f63c1
JOROX_STANDBY_TEAM=norax